The contract involves the on-site removal and reinstallation of an Oxford EDS UltimMax 100 energy dispersive spectrometer detector on a Hitachi NX9000 scanning electron microscope located at Eglin Air Force Base in Goulds, Florida. The scope includes complete handling, secure packaging, transportation, and precise reinstallation of the detector within a controlled laboratory environment, ensuring the integrity of the sensitive equipment throughout the process. Integration verification is required to confirm that the detector functions correctly after reinstallation and is fully operational within the SEM system. All work must be performed in compliance with federal procurement standards under the North American Industry Classification System code 272110, with a response deadline of July 1, 2026, at 6:00 PM. The contract is classified as a subcontract under the Department of Defense, with the Department of the Air Force as the overseeing agency. The performance location is specified as Goulds, Florida, with a ZIP code of 32542, and all activities must adhere to the security and operational protocols of the military installation.

Notice of Intent to Sole Source 60-ton Crane Repair
Solicitation # FA4626-SoleSource-CraneRepair
The Department of the Air Force, through the 341st Contracting Squadron, intends to award a sole-source contract to MGX Equipment Services, LLC for the complex repair of a 2007 Grove TMS700E 60-ton crane (AF Registration 07D00453) supporting the 819th Red Horse Squadron at Malmstrom Air Force Base. The asset is currently non-operational due to a hydraulic leak requiring major drive-train disassembly and the replacement of a 5-port hydraulic swivel manifold assembly. To certify the crane as fully functional, the scope of work includes replacing wire rope, o-rings, a fill cap with breather, elements, lock pins, seal kits, and a slip ring assembly, as well as performing structural inspections. All work must be executed by authorized Grove technicians and adhere to OEM specifications as identified in Technical Order 36-1-191. Because the crane cannot be driven and the government lacks a sufficiently large transport trailer, the asset must be transported to the MGX Equipment Services facility in Billings, Montana. The total estimated value for the requirement is 53,565.41, which covers all labor, parts, and return transportation. This action is being pursued as a sole-source procurement because MGX Equipment Services is the only authorized dealer in Montana with the necessary infrastructure and capabilities to perform these specific complex repairs. Interested parties were required to submit capability statements or quotations by September 25, 2026, to demonstrate that competition would be advantageous to the government.
